首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Mysql正在尝试加载卸载的插件

MySQL是一种开源的关系型数据库管理系统,它支持多种插件来扩展其功能。插件是一种可加载和卸载的软件模块,可以为MySQL提供额外的功能和特性。

MySQL插件可以分为两类:内置插件和外部插件。内置插件是MySQL自带的,而外部插件是由第三方开发并可以通过加载和卸载来添加或移除的。

加载和卸载插件是通过使用MySQL的插件管理语句来完成的。在加载插件时,MySQL会将插件的相关文件加载到内存中,并将其注册为可用的功能。而在卸载插件时,MySQL会释放插件占用的内存,并将其从可用功能中移除。

加载和卸载插件可以为MySQL提供以下优势:

  1. 扩展功能:插件可以为MySQL提供额外的功能和特性,如存储引擎、复制、安全性等方面的增强。
  2. 灵活性:通过加载和卸载插件,可以根据实际需求来扩展或减少MySQL的功能,从而提高系统的灵活性和可定制性。
  3. 性能优化:某些插件可以通过优化查询、缓存数据等方式来提高MySQL的性能。
  4. 安全性:插件可以提供额外的安全功能,如加密、身份验证等,从而增强数据库的安全性。

加载和卸载插件的过程可以通过以下步骤来完成:

  1. 确认插件是否已安装:使用SHOW PLUGINS语句可以查看当前已安装的插件列表。
  2. 加载插件:使用INSTALL PLUGIN语句可以加载一个插件。语法为:INSTALL PLUGIN plugin_name SONAME 'plugin_library'。其中,plugin_name是插件的名称,plugin_library是插件的库文件。
  3. 卸载插件:使用UNINSTALL PLUGIN语句可以卸载一个插件。语法为:UNINSTALL PLUGIN plugin_name。其中,plugin_name是要卸载的插件的名称。

需要注意的是,加载和卸载插件可能需要特定的权限,因此在执行相关操作时需要确保具有足够的权限。

对于MySQL,腾讯云提供了云数据库MySQL服务(TencentDB for MySQL),它是基于MySQL开发的一种云数据库解决方案。腾讯云的云数据库MySQL支持插件的加载和卸载,用户可以根据自己的需求来扩展MySQL的功能。具体关于腾讯云云数据库MySQL的信息和产品介绍可以参考以下链接:

通过腾讯云云数据库MySQL,用户可以方便地管理和扩展MySQL的插件,从而满足各种不同的业务需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券